Resources moving from declining sectors to expanding ones and stopping in equilibrium demonstrate the way the market mechanism (price mechanism) operates. This was first spotted by Adam Smith in the Wealth of Nations as early as 1776 although the diagrams did not come until later.

The metadata describes the … Web22 jun. 2024 · The price mechanism is the most fundamental way scarce resource are allocated efficiently and it has a few effects: Allocates resources – In the first lesson, it was discussed that resources are scarce and finite. The price mechanism allows the finite resource to be distributed among consumers efficiently (i.e. there is no wasted resources).
